Join us for a unique live DJ set featuring orchestral musicians, blending traditional and contemporary South Asian sounds.
Almass Badat is an international DJ, MC and broadcaster who weaves global sounds with cultural crossover and live instrumentation. Her DJ sets uplift and connect people, journeying through her South Asian heritage, Lusaka and London upbringing, and world travels. If you see her live, you’ll catch yourself singing and moving along with Almass but dancing to your own beat – the epitome of exploring yourself through music.
This immersive performance will highlight the profound contributions of women in Sufi music as closing event to the É«¶à¶àÊÓƵ Museum’s summer exhibition Awaken: Sufi Music & Women of South Asia.
